Frequently Asked Questions about Englewood
How much are Studio apartments in Englewood?
There are currently 271 Studio Apartments in Englewood with rent ranges from $795 to $2,200 with an average price of $1,583.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Englewood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Englewood ranges from $684 to $5,032 with an average monthly rent of $1,840.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Englewood c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Englewood range from $306 to $6,724.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,415.
How expensive are Englewood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 109 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Englewood on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,336 to $8,713 - averaging $3,192 for the location.
